Monte Tamaro stands as the crowning peak of the Lugano Prealps, rising 1,962 m above sea level and commanding sweeping views of both Lake Maggiore and Lake Lugano. Nestled in the Swiss canton of Ticino, the mountain offers a striking blend of alpine scenery and Mediterranean charm, making it a beloved destination for hikers, nature lovers and adventure seekers alike. With a prominence of 1,408 m and an isolation of 13.3 km, Monte Tamaro dominates the surrounding landscape, earning a prominent spot in the International SOIUSA classification as the highest summit of the Lugano Prealps. Its distinctive granite ridges and accessible trails showcase the geological diversity of the region and provide ample opportunities for both casual strolls and more demanding climbs. One of the most popular ways to reach the summit is the Monte Tamaro Cable Car, which whisk visitors from the valley floor to a station 1,500 m above sea level within minutes. From the cable car’s terminus, a network of well-marked paths leads to the crystal‑clear summit platform, offering panoramic vistas of the lakes, the Alps to the north, and the rolling Ticino countryside to the south. Besides the cable car, visitors can explore extensive hiking routes that weave through forested slopes, alpine meadows, and rocky outcrops, each providing unique photographic opportunities and encounters with local wildlife. In summer, the mountain is a playground for trekkers, mountain bikers, and paragliders; in winter, the nearby ski area hosts cross‑country enthusiasts.
